Sarasota County Early Voting 2016: Where to Cast Your Ballot
Sarasota County voters who want to beat the Nov. 8 rush will find early voting starts Monday, Oct. 24.

SARASOTA, FL — Sarasota County voters with no desire to stand in lines come Nov. 8 can cast their ballot in the 2016 general election early. The county’s early voting period opens Monday, Oct. 24 and runs through Saturday, Nov. 5.
Early voting locations established by the Sarasota County Supervisor of Elections Office are open from 8:30 a.m. to 6:30 p.m. daily. Here are the locations early voters can cast their ballots:

In order to vote in the general election, people must have registered on or before Oct. 18, 2016. Voters should bring a current and valid photo and signature ID with them to the polls. Acceptable forms of identification include, but are not limited to, a Florida driver’s license or state identification card, public assistance ID, military ID and concealed weapons license.
